    CQG data vs Zen-Fire

    Has anyone switched to CQG data yet? I currently use Zen-Fire / Rithmic and am curious if the data is faster, slower, no difference? Any experiences appreciated.

    #2
    Hi Tdschulz,

    I currently testing AMP/CQG against ZenFire. At the moment I would say ZenFire is a bit faster and the Level2 quotes update process looks much better.
    With my demo version of CQG/AMP I don't recieve any historical data from CQG. The data that you get are the recorded ZenFire data from the Ninja servers.

      No support of static dome

      I've switched and am not happy thus far. Big problem is that they currently only support a dynamic dome. Annoying if you've paid for the Ninja license and are used to a static dome.

        Have not switched to CQG but am planning to give it a shot as soon as the next release of NT comes out. Looks like there are some pro's and cons. Pros being the supported indexes that are not available with ZenFire. Cons are the issue with the Static Dom or should I say lack thereof.

        Suppose each NT, AMP user will have to decide which is more important.

          I've switched and am not happy thus far. Big problem is that they currently only support a dynamic dome. Annoying if you've paid for the Ninja license and are used to a static dome.
          The Static SuperDOM will be made available as an option. You must route your request to your broker to have your SuperDOM switched to static. You can do this starting tomorrow or next Monday.
